Police detective Alex Collingheim investigates the murder of a well-known journalist famous for scandalous political reports. Since the victim had a second citizenship of matriarchal Kitiara, at the insistence of the authorities of her home planet a Kitiaran woman, Tiny Rowell, is attached to the investigation. Moreover, she is a typical product of genetic engineering. She understands absolutely nothing about crimes, because by profession she is an analyst in the field of social anthropology. In general, trouble is expected from her far more than benefit. At least that’s what Alex thinks at first glance.
